What Causes This Problem
- Faulty electrical wiring often ignites fires in residential properties.
- Unattended cooking is a leading cause of fire incidents at home.
- Heating equipment failures can start fires during colder months.
- Improper storage of flammable materials increases fire risk indoors.
- Smoking indoors without proper disposal can trigger house fires.

Service Cost In Carrollton, TX
Emergency fire damage assessment in Carrollton typically ranges from $250 to $600, depending on fire severity, property size, and inspection complexity; these are estimates to help you plan.

What Should I Expect During An Emergency Fire Damage Assessment?
Expect a detailed inspection covering all affected areas, including structural and content evaluation, plus a clear report outlining damage severity and next steps.
